Re: ABI_OPT_PERL semi-broken on Win32


Subject: Re: ABI_OPT_PERL semi-broken on Win32
From: Nikolaj Brandt Jensen (mailbag@postman.dk)
Date: Thu Sep 13 2001 - 12:30:38 CDT


On Thu, 13 Sep 2001 08:55:38 +0200, you wrote:

Hi Joaquin

>> I have been running into a problem compiling with ABI_OPT_PERL=1 on
>> Windows.
>
>There are brave souls out there... :-)

No challenges, no fun :-)

I have changed my setup now, but I will try to reproduce the problem
with ABI_OPT_PERL...

>> BTW: The ie_exp_Applix.cpp and ie_exp_GZipAbiWord.cpp (and more?) are
>> also broken.
>
>What are the error messages that you're getting?

It only happens when ABI_OPT_PERL is defined, didn't check that last
night. The errors are like these:

ie_exp_AWT.cpp(35) : error C2448: '<Unknown>' : function-style
initializer appears to be a function definition
ie_exp_AWT.cpp(35) : fatal error C1004: unexpected end of file found
make[4]: *** [/abi/abi/src/WIN32_1.3.2_i386_OBJ/obj/ie_exp_AWT.obj]
Error 2

ie_exp_WML.cpp(109) : warning C4518: '__declspec(dllexport ) int ' :
storage-cla
ss or type specifier(s) unexpected here; ignored
ie_exp_WML.cpp(109) : warning C4230: anachronism used :
modifiers/qualifiers int
erspersed, qualifier ignored
ie_exp_WML.cpp(132) : warning C4518: '__declspec(dllexport ) int ' :
storage-cla
ss or type specifier(s) unexpected here; ignored
ie_exp_WML.cpp(132) : warning C4230: anachronism used :
modifiers/qualifiers int
erspersed, qualifier ignored
ie_exp_WML.cpp(152) : warning C4518: '__declspec(dllexport ) int ' :
storage-cla
ss or type specifier(s) unexpected here; ignored
ie_exp_WML.cpp(152) : warning C4230: anachronism used :
modifiers/qualifiers int
erspersed, qualifier ignored

ie_exp_Psion.cpp(786) : error C2143: syntax error : missing ';' before
':'
make[4]: *** [/abi/abi/src/WIN32_1.3.2_i386_OBJ/obj/ie_exp_Psion.obj]
Error 2

I have not looked at this at all, but if you figure something out, I
will be happy to test it.

        - Nikolaj



This archive was generated by hypermail 2b25 : Thu Sep 13 2001 - 12:30:49 CDT